Dersin Kodu | Dersin Adı | Dersin Türü | Yıl | Yarıyıl | AKTS | Kredi |
---|---|---|---|---|---|---|
OMBT212 | İşlemci Mimarileri | Seçmeli Ders Grubu | 2 | 4 | 4.00 | 2.00 |
Önlisans
Türkçe
Mikroişlemcilerin ve mikrodenetleyicilerin tanıtılması, bellek türlerinin tanıtılması, PIC assembly dilinin öğretilmesi ve çeşitli uygulamalar yapılması.
Dr.Öğretim Üyesi İlhan GARİP
1 | Mikroişlemciler ve mikrodenetleyiciler hakkında temel bilgiye sahiptir. |
2 | Bir mühendislik probleminin çözümü için algoritma geliştirebilir. |
3 | Assembly dilinde program yazabilir. |
4 | Mikroişlemci kullanarak sayısal sistemler tasarlayabilir. |
Birinci Öğretim
Yok
Mikroişlemci sistemlerine giriş, sayısal gösterim ve sayı sistemleri, lojik elemanlar ve donanım aygıtları, bellekler, merkezi işlem birimi (MİB) yapısı ve çalışması, kontrol ünitesi, genel ve özel amaçlı saklayıcılar, giriş/çıkış ve doğrudan bellek erişimi, PIC16F877A yapısı ve özellikleri, adresleme modları ve komutlar, altprogramlar, kesme ve yığın yapısı, veri transferi, PIC ile PWM tekniği, PIC ile analog/sayısal dönüşüm, assembly
Hafta | Teorik | Uygulama | [OgretimYontemVeTeknikleri] | [OnHazirlik] |
---|---|---|---|---|
1 | Mikroişlemci ve mikrodenetleyici nedir? | |||
2 | Bellek türleri ve PIC özellikleri | |||
3 | Algoritmalar ve akış şemaları | |||
4 | PIC komut seti | |||
5 | PIC komut seti | |||
6 | PIC bank organizasyonu ve Durum saklayıcısı, W saklayıcısı, Karşılaştırma, Port ayarlama | |||
7 | Karar, Döngü, Alt programlar, Gecikme alt programı | |||
8 | Örneklerle Proteus Dizayn Yazılımı | |||
9 | PIC mikrodenetleyicisi ile PWM tekniği | |||
10 | 7-Segment gösterge | |||
11 | PIC mikrodenetleyicisi ile aritmetik işlemler | |||
12 | ADC ve DAC’ler, PIC mikrodenetleyicisi ile A/D | |||
13 | Mikrodenetleyici projeleri | |||
14 | Proje Sunumları | |||
15 | Final Sınavı |
1. Myke Predko, Programming and Customizing the PIC Microcontroller, 3rd edt., McGraw-Hill, 2007 2. John Morton, The PIC Microcontroller: Your Personal Introductory Course, 3rd edt., Newnes, 2005 3. Tim Wilmshurst, Designing Embedded Systems with PIC Microcontrollers: Principles and Applications, 2nd edt., Newnes, 2009 4. Mikroislemcilere Giris: Assembler ile Yazılım ve Arayüz Mehmet BODUR EMO yayını 2014
Yarıyıl (Yıl) İçi Etkinlikleri | Adet | Değer |
---|---|---|
Ara Sınav | 1 | 100 |
Toplam | 100 | |
Yarıyıl (Yıl) Sonu Etkinlikleri | Adet | Değer |
Final Sınavı | 1 | 100 |
Toplam | 100 | |
Yarıyıl (Yıl) İçi Etkinlikleri | 40 | |
Yarıyıl (Yıl) Sonu Etkinlikleri | 60 |
Etkinlikler | Sayısı | Süresi (saat) | Toplam İş Yükü (saat) |
---|---|---|---|
Final Sınavı | 1 | 2 | 2 |
Derse Katılım | 14 | 2 | 28 |
Proje Sunma | 1 | 20 | 20 |
Bireysel Çalışma | 14 | 1 | 14 |
Ödev Problemleri için Bireysel Çalışma | 3 | 5 | 15 |
Ara Sınav İçin Bireysel Çalışma | 1 | 11 | 11 |
Final Sınavı içiin Bireysel Çalışma | 1 | 10 | 10 |
Toplam İş Yükü (saat) | 100 |
PÇ 1 | PÇ 2 | PÇ 3 | PÇ 4 | PÇ 5 | PÇ 6 | PÇ 7 | PÇ 8 | PÇ 9 | PÇ 10 | PÇ 11 | PÇ 12 | PÇ 13 | PÇ 14 | PÇ 15 | |
ÖÇ 1 | 5 | ||||||||||||||
ÖÇ 2 | 5 | ||||||||||||||
ÖÇ 3 | 5 | ||||||||||||||
ÖÇ 4 | 5 |